Polestar nearing inflection point as deliveries ramp up, says Bank of America

Polestar is a pure-play electric vehicle manufacturer on the cusp of an inflection point, according to Bank of America analysts.

Polestar “offers pure-play exposure to the growing EV market, is nearing an inflection point in sales volumes, and is improving its earnings profile”, they said in a research note.

BofA highlighted increased production of Polestar's higher-margin CUV/SUV models, the Polestar 3 and 4, as a key driver of projected growth.

Deliveries are expected to rise from approximately 50,000 units in 2023 to 150,000 units by 2030.

The bank estimated an additional upside of up to 40% if EV demand accelerates or Polestar's new active sales model, leveraging dealer networks, proves effective.

Despite these positives, the automaker faces risks related to its Chinese ownership and potential changes to US trade and subsidy policies when president-elect Donald Trump takes office.

The path to positive free cash flow is projected to remain challenging, with sustainability not expected until 2029 or 2030.

BofA forecasts that Polestar will need an additional $3 billion to $4 billion in capital to achieve self funding.

The bank initiated coverage on the stock with a neutral rating and £1.25 price target.

Shares were swapping for a flat $1 at the time of writing.
